    This station has the most lines travelling through it on the whole network, which including: Circle, Hammersmith & City, Metropolitan, Northern, Piccadilly and Victoria, with a total of 8 platforms.

    The Pentonville Road entrance is only open Monday to Friday 07:00 to 20:00. This was once the ticket office of the now disused King's Cross Thameslink railway station.

    If you are traveling north on the Victoria Line and need to change to Northern, make sure you walk to the end of the Victoria line platform, there is a small passage that leads to the Northern line!
